About This Certification

Who Is This For?

This certification is designed for health and safety managers, occupational safety officers, and leaders in organisations seeking to enhance their health and safety systems. Candidates typically possess several years of experience in occupational safety and are looking to advance their careers by gaining expertise in ISO 45001 standards.
